        Nellie is usually such a good bun, but lately she just has not been herself. She’s been peeing a TINY bit on my bed, (not a big problem because it’s a tiny spot and I don’t even sleep in that room or use that mattress) moving her litter box around, throwing her litter out of the box, throwing her food bowl around and spilling it, and lunging at me when I reach in her cage to feed her. None of this has been a problem for the past 7 months that I’ve had her. Does anyone know what could be causing this behavior? She has an appointment for her spay in 3 weeks, maybe that will help?

          Ah Puberty Bunny… Such sweet little darlings they become… Yes, the spay should help also don’t give in to the lunging. When I got Nermal back from her “Not so forever home” she was quite the Madam… I suspect that was more the reason they returned her than the excuse the kids were to busy with school. Nomnoms would lunge and box and stomp her front feet at me so I just ignore it and rubbed the sweet spot between her eyes… We met an accord and as long as Madam Nermal De Nomnoms got her nose scritches she behave until she was finally spayed.
